Global Markets on Edge: US Fed Eases, BoJ Risks Loom, AI Boom & New Fed Chair's Test – Indian Investors Alert!

The US Federal Reserve is signaling a period of gradual monetary easing, but global financial markets face potential volatility. Key concerns include aggressive policy shifts from the Bank of Japan and historical market reactions to new Federal Reserve chairs.

Global Central Bank Outlook

  • The US Federal Reserve's path towards gradual monetary easing, including a 25 basis point rate cut, is largely anticipated by the market.
  • Ed Clissold of Ned Davis Research notes a shift in the FOMC's dynamics, moving towards a more vote-dependent decision-making process.
  • A significant risk emerges from the Bank of Japan, as aggressive rate hikes while other central banks are cutting could disrupt the Yen carry trade and lead to market turbulence.

The AI Tech Stock Phenomenon

  • Despite concerns about an "AI bubble," US technology stocks, particularly the 'Magnificent Seven', have maintained an "overweight" status.
  • This preference is driven by the prevailing slow-growth economic environment, where investors are willing to pay a premium for companies that can consistently deliver sales growth.
  • While valuations for these tech giants are historically stretched, their long-term growth narrative continues to be a primary focus for investors.

New Fed Chair's Market Test

  • Historical analysis reveals a recurring pattern: markets tend to experience significant corrections, averaging around 15%, within the first six months of a new Federal Reserve chair's tenure.
  • This phenomenon, described as the market "testing the new Fed chair," was notably observed in December 2018 when markets reacted sharply to policy signals.

Future Risks and Challenges

  • A significant looming issue for the next Fed chair is the potential challenge to the central bank's independence.
  • Implementing further rate cuts without a substantial drop in inflation could risk unanchoring long-term inflation expectations, potentially leading to wider credit spreads and a steeper yield curve.
  • This scenario could create a complex and "politically tricky situation" that the US has not faced in decades.

Impact

  • Global equity markets may experience increased volatility due to diverging central bank policies, particularly between the US Federal Reserve and the Bank of Japan.
  • The technology sector, driven by AI, could see continued investor interest despite stretched valuations, but is also susceptible to broader market corrections.
  • Changes in Federal Reserve leadership and policy decisions can trigger significant market adjustments and influence investor sentiment.

Difficult Terms Explained

  • Basis point: A unit of measure equal to one-hundredth of one percent (0.01%). Often used to describe changes in interest rates or other financial percentages.
  • FOMC: The Federal Open Market Committee is the principal monetary policymaking body of the Federal Reserve System.
  • Yen carry trade: An investment strategy where an investor borrows money in a currency with a low interest rate (like the Japanese Yen) and invests it in an asset denominated in a currency with a high interest rate, aiming to profit from the interest rate differential.
  • Magnificent Seven: A colloquial term for seven of the largest and most influential technology companies in the United States: Apple, Microsoft, Alphabet (Google), Amazon, Nvidia, Meta Platforms (Facebook), and Tesla.
  • Price-to-earnings (P/E) ratio: A valuation ratio of a company's share price to its earnings per share. It is used by investors to determine the relative trading value of a stock.
  • Yield curve: A graph that plots the yields of bonds having equal credit quality but differing maturity dates. The curve typically slopes upward, reflecting higher yields for longer-term bonds.
  • Credit spreads: The difference in yield between two different types of debt instruments, typically corporate bonds and government bonds, with similar maturities. It reflects the perceived credit risk of the corporate issuer.
